Introduction

Pharmaceutical companies argued that the prescription of opioids on patients would not have any side effects on the patients that they were used on. Therefore, the use of opioids on patients experiencing mild and extreme pains was widely accepted and used by the medical practitioners in larger numbers. With the increased prescription of opioids, there arose the diversion and misuse of the prescriptions, since the previously-made assurance that the opioids would not lead to addiction was not fulfilled.

Facts from the Opioids Crisis

As of 2017, the opioids crisis had affected American society so much that at least 47,000 Americans had died from the complications related to the scourge. Opioids were abused in different forms ranging from prescription opioids, heroin, fentanyl that had been illicitly manufactured, which resulted in a powerfully synthesized variation of the opiates. Additionally, an estimated 1.7 million people suffered from the effects of addiction from the prescription opioids and the disorders associated with the overdose of the use of prescription and non-prescription opioids.

To deal with the opioids crisis, the US department of health has come up with major steps to help in the process of recovery from the damage that the addiction has had on society thus far. First, the department has undertaken serious steps towards facilitating the treatment of the victims of the crisis. Therefore, there have been concerted efforts towards helping the victims recover from the effects that they may have experienced from the use of the prescription and non-prescription opioids secondly, the department has undertaken steps towards promoting the use of drugs that will reverse the effects of the drugs that the victims may have gotten in the course of their addiction. It is therefore pertinent that the department advocates for drugs that will substitute the opioids and the effects that they bring to the victims.

Additionally, the department has continued their surveillance of the health issue that the society faces as a result of the addiction to the opioids that the Americans have been addicted to, thus providing them with further understanding on the crisis, its causes, the effects and the preventive measures that can be put in place to avoid future occurrences of the problem. Therefore, it is through this point that the department has been able to address the social aspects of the crisis and how the medical aspects of the issue can be traced to its effects. More importantly, the department has continued to engage in cutting-edge research to help them in developing other methods of pain management, so that the use of opioids in the field can be successfully eradicated due to the addiction it causes upon its use.
